Small scratch on my apple watch 3 42

Hi. I got a minor scratch on my applewatch, stretching from the left side to the right side almost on top of the screen. I barely can’t see it but i can feel it very well, and when i look very close up.

The picture is totally normal, but the the touchscreen-function isnt. I can only use the right side of the touchscreen, allowing me to press number 3,6 and 9 when entering the code.


So, the scratch is nowhere near the bottom of the screen, but i still cant use that position of the touchscreen.


Any advise on this? Is there anything i can try and do myself to fix this problem, given how small the scratch is, and how perfectly the clock is working inside. Why is the bottomtouch area not working when the scratch is so small and on the top? Do i need a totally new screen, or is there any trick?

I suspect the small scratch is actually a cracked screen. Please see Screen Replacement Program for Aluminum Models of Apple Watch Series 2 and Series 3 - Apple Support and consider the service options it mentions.
